// Copyright (c) Microsoft Corporation. All rights reserved.
// Licensed under the MIT License.
using System;
using System.Collections.Generic;
using System.Management.Automation;
using System.Management.Automation.Language;
using System.Linq;
using System.Collections.ObjectModel;
using Microsoft.PowerShell.Commands;
namespace Microsoft.PowerShell.PSResourceGet.UtilClasses
{
/// <summary>
/// This class contains information for a PSScriptFileInfo (representing a .ps1 file contents).
/// </summary>
public sealed class PSScriptRequires
{
#region Properties
/// <summary>
/// The modules this script requires, specified like: #requires -Module NetAdapter#requires -Module @{Name="NetAdapter"; Version="1.0.0.0"}
/// Hashtable keys: GUID, MaxVersion, ModuleName (Required), RequiredVersion, Version.
/// </summary>
public ModuleSpecification[] RequiredModules { get; private set; } = Array.Empty<ModuleSpecification>();
/// <summary>
/// Specifies if this script requires elevated privileges, specified like: #requires -RunAsAdministrator
/// </summary>
public bool IsElevationRequired { get; private set; }
/// <summary>
/// The application id this script requires, specified like: #requires -Shellid Shell
/// </summary>
public string RequiredApplicationId { get; private set; }
/// <summary>
/// The assemblies this script requires, specified like: #requires -Assembly path\to\foo.dll#requires -Assembly "System.Management.Automation, Version=3.0.0.0, Culture=neutral, PublicKeyToken=31bf3856ad364e35"
/// </summary>
public string[] RequiredAssemblies { get; private set; } = Utils.EmptyStrArray;
/// <summary>
/// The PowerShell Edition this script requires, specified like: #requires -PSEdition Desktop
/// </summary>
public string[] RequiredPSEditions { get; private set; } = Utils.EmptyStrArray;
/// <summary>
/// The PowerShell version this script requires, specified like: #requires -Version 3
/// </summary>
public Version RequiredPSVersion { get; private set; }
#endregion
#region Constructor
/// <summary>
/// This constructor creates a new PSScriptRequires instance with specified required modules.
/// </summary>
public PSScriptRequires(ModuleSpecification[] requiredModules)
{
RequiredModules = requiredModules ?? Array.Empty<ModuleSpecification>();
}
/// <summary>
/// This constructor is called by internal cmdlet methods and creates a PSScriptHelp with default values
/// for the parameters. Calling a method like PSScriptRequires.ParseContentIntoObj() would then populate those properties.
/// </summary>
internal PSScriptRequires() {}
#endregion
#region Internal Methods
/// <summary>
/// Parses RequiredModules out of comment lines and validates during parse process.
/// </summary>
internal bool ParseContentIntoObj(string[] commentLines, out ErrorRecord[] errors)
{
/**
When Requires comment lines are obtained from .ps1 file they will have this format:
#Requires -Module RequiredModule1
#Requires -Module @{ ModuleName = 'RequiredModule2'; ModuleVersion = '2.0' }
#Requires -Module @{ ModuleName = 'RequiredModule3'; RequiredVersion = '2.5' }
#Requires -Module @{ ModuleName = 'RequiredModule4'; ModuleVersion = '1.1'; MaximumVersion = '2.0' }
#Requires -Module @{ ModuleName = 'RequiredModule5'; MaximumVersion = '1.5' }
*/
errors = Array.Empty<ErrorRecord>();
List<ErrorRecord> errorsList = new List<ErrorRecord>();
string requiresComment = String.Join(Environment.NewLine, commentLines);
try
{
var ast = Parser.ParseInput(
requiresComment,
out Token[] tokens,
out ParseError[] parserErrors);
if (parserErrors.Length > 0)
{
foreach (ParseError err in parserErrors)
{
errorsList.Add(new ErrorRecord(
new InvalidOperationException($"Could not requires comments as valid PowerShell input due to {err.Message}."),
err.ErrorId,
ErrorCategory.ParserError,
null));
}
errors = errorsList.ToArray();
return false;
}
// get .REQUIREDMODULES property, by accessing the System.Management.Automation.Language.ScriptRequirements object ScriptRequirements.RequiredModules property
ScriptRequirements parsedScriptRequirements = ast.ScriptRequirements;
ReadOnlyCollection<ModuleSpecification> parsedModules = new List<ModuleSpecification>().AsReadOnly();
if (parsedScriptRequirements != null)
{
// System.Management.Automation.Language.ScriptRequirements properties are listed here:
// https://learn.microsoft.com/en-us/dotnet/api/system.management.automation.language.scriptrequirements?view=powershellsdk-7.4.0
if (parsedScriptRequirements.IsElevationRequired)
{
IsElevationRequired = true;
}
if (parsedScriptRequirements.RequiredApplicationId != null)
{
RequiredApplicationId = parsedScriptRequirements.RequiredApplicationId;
}
if (parsedScriptRequirements.RequiredAssemblies != null)
{
RequiredAssemblies = parsedScriptRequirements.RequiredAssemblies.ToArray();
}
if (parsedScriptRequirements.RequiredModules != null)
{
RequiredModules = parsedScriptRequirements.RequiredModules.ToArray();
}
if (parsedScriptRequirements.RequiredPSEditions != null)
{
RequiredPSEditions = parsedScriptRequirements.RequiredPSEditions.ToArray();
}
if (parsedScriptRequirements.RequiredPSVersion != null)
{
RequiredPSVersion = parsedScriptRequirements.RequiredPSVersion;
}
}
}
catch (Exception e)
{
errorsList.Add(new ErrorRecord(
new ArgumentException($"Parsing RequiredModules failed due to {e.Message}"),
"requiredModulesAstParseThrewError",
ErrorCategory.ParserError,
null));
errors = errorsList.ToArray();
return false;
}
return true;
}
/// <summary>
/// Emits string representation of '#Requires ...' comment(s).
/// </summary>
internal string[] EmitContent()
{
List<string> psRequiresLines = new List<string>();
if (IsElevationRequired)
{
psRequiresLines.Add(String.Empty);
psRequiresLines.Add("#Requires -RunAsAdministrator");
}
if (!String.IsNullOrEmpty(RequiredApplicationId))
{
psRequiresLines.Add(String.Empty);
psRequiresLines.Add(String.Format("#Requires -ShellId {0}", RequiredApplicationId));
}
if (RequiredAssemblies.Length > 0)
{
psRequiresLines.Add(String.Empty);
foreach (string assembly in RequiredAssemblies)
{
psRequiresLines.Add(String.Format("#Requires -Assembly {0}", assembly));
}
}
if (RequiredPSEditions.Length > 0)
{
psRequiresLines.Add(String.Empty);
foreach (string psEdition in RequiredPSEditions)
{
psRequiresLines.Add(String.Format("#Requires -PSEdition {0}", psEdition));
}
}
if (RequiredPSVersion != null)
{
psRequiresLines.Add(String.Empty);
psRequiresLines.Add(String.Format("#Requires -Version {0}", RequiredPSVersion.ToString()));
}
if (RequiredModules.Length > 0)
{
psRequiresLines.Add(String.Empty);
foreach (ModuleSpecification moduleSpec in RequiredModules)
{
psRequiresLines.Add(String.Format("#Requires -Module {0}", moduleSpec.ToString()));
}
psRequiresLines.Add(String.Empty);
}
return psRequiresLines.ToArray();
}
/// <summary>
/// Updates the current Requires content with another (passed in), effectively replaces it.
/// </summary>
internal void UpdateContent(ModuleSpecification[] requiredModules)
{
if (requiredModules != null && requiredModules.Length != 0){
RequiredModules = requiredModules;
}
}
#endregion
}
}
